For interpreting there is a semi-official qualification (DPSI from the IoL) and a national register of public service interpreters (NRPSI). However, right now there is an ongoing problem because public service departments (hospitals, courts, etc.) that ought to be using this register are using agencies instead.
So, apart from the police, everybody else is using an agency (as far as I know). In fact, even the police will use an agency sometimes.
